1 # Disable all systemd related macros
4 %systemd_service_enable() %{nil}
5 %systemd_service_disable() %{nil}
6 %systemd_service() %{nil}
7 %systemd_service_start() %{nil}
8 %systemd_service_stop() %{nil}
9 %systemd_service_restart() %{nil}
10 %systemd_service_reload() %{nil}
11 %systemd_trigger() %{nil}
12 %systemd_post() %{nil}
13 %systemd_preun() %{nil}
15 # Keep paths for systemd related files
16 %systemdunitdir /lib/systemd/system
17 %systemduserunitdir /usr/lib/systemd/user
18 %systemdtmpfilesdir /usr/lib/tmpfiles.d
19 %journal_catalog_update %{nil}
21 # Macro for excluding above paths from package contents
22 %exclude_systemd_files\
23 %exclude /lib/systemd\
24 %exclude /usr/lib/systemd\
25 %exclude %{systemdtmpfilesdir}\